Recreating Voodoo Graphics and a Late-1990s Gaming PC on an FPGA

Summary

The article documents recreating the 3dfx Voodoo Graphics processor on an FPGA as part of the z486 MiSTer project, forming a complete DOS PC (z486 XL) with Voodoo graphics on a KV260 board. It covers the design approach, memory architecture, and pipeline details of zSST, along with performance benchmarks and open-source context.
